Transaction 151868fdb8b6a740f4868581be26c63c240bcd3a9c5b93ead5c336070d991e19
1 Input
1 Output
-
151868fdb8b6a740f4868581be26c63c240bcd3a9c5b93ead5c336070d991e19:0
- value
- 533798
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6163238a486d6b32fc0b6cbbd92e18beed8a75e
- address
- bc1q7ctryw9ysmttxt7qkm9mmyhp30hd3f67e9gmpt